Introduction
This laboratory exercise is done in order to observe mitosis through the observation of
an onion root tip. Different cyctochemical techniques are also used in the preparation of
the mitosis slide.
Objectives
1. To be able to observe mitosis using an onion root tip.
2. To know the appearance of different stages of mitosis.
Materials
Onion root tip glass slide cover slip compound microscope
Ethanol aceto orcein scalpel chloroform beaker
Procedures
1. Cut onion root tip about 1mm long.
2. Prepare fixative solution in a beaker (3mL chloroform, 1mL ethanol)
3. Transfer onion root in the fixative solution. Soak for 45 minutes
4. After 45 minutes, place one root tip on the slide. Macerate gently.
5. Add one drop of aceto orcein. Stand for 10 minutes. Cover. Blot. Focus under the
microscope.
6. Observe stages of mitosis.
A problem that was encountered is putting too much amount of aceto orcein. Because
of this, some the onion root tip’s parts are not visibly seen.
